The sum of two opposite angles of a quadrilateral is 172o. The other two angles of the quadrilateral are equal. Find the equal angles.

Solution

Solution:-
Let the measurement of equal angles be x°.
As we know that sum of all the angles of a quadrilateral is 360°.
Given that sum of 2 angles of quadrilatral is 172°.
172°+x°+x°=360°
2x°=360°172°
x°=188°2
x°=94°
Hence, the equal angles are of 94° each.
